Curl bad certificate. Just like milk, SSL certificates have an expiration date.
Curl bad certificate If the website’s certificate is expired, curl won’t trust it. xyz -port 9093 I get the following error: 139810559764296:error:14094412:SSL routines:SSL3_READ_BYTES:sslv3 alert bad certificate:s3_p * stopped the pause stream! * Closing connection 0 curl: (35) error:14094412:SSL routines:ssl3_read_bytes:sslv3 alert bad certificate I'm a little unsure of how to pursue identifying what the issue is here. Sep 26, 2025 · Learn to handle SSL errors in cURL, including using self-signed certificates, ignore options. This makes all connections considered "insecure" fail unless -k, --insecure is used. Learn how to fix SSL certificate verification errors in cURL commands. Instruct curl to ignore ssl errors and connect to the web server. Sep 23, 2013 · Safari uses keychain so I presume trusting the certificate adds it to the list of trusted certificates system-wide, which also allows curl to work with the same certificate. Note the certificate you've displayed is indeed not a proper client certificate since it appears to be a self-signed CA root certificate. The server has failed the handshake for the reason indicated. Explore common issues, safe cURL practices. diqmgf gfai pdjmt ytk lmmjf jutjei zibfu rzc ukhs kctngf cobt vqcj dpvbgn hhwvf rlbzs